Active Substances Sample Clauses

Active Substances. Nothing in this Agreement infers applicability of the Technology by LICENSEE for enabling active substance incorporation and potentiation in LICENSEE’s End Products, other than those End Products derived from hemp. LICENSEE is strictly prohibited from developing, manufacturing or selling, whether directly or indirectly, including through its Partner, in its Territory, any End Product that is classified as, or is deemed to be, a pharmaceutical product by a national health regulatory agency and has been approved for use for specific therapeutic indications and/or any End Product that bears a label making either a therapeutic or structure/function claim ascribed to the active substances derived from hemp or can only be provided to end users upon physician consultation. The LICENSEE is further prohibited from developing manufacturing or selling, whether directly or indirectly, including through its Partner in its Territory, any End Product that is marketed as the following types of products: (i) a fat soluble vitamin product for vitamins A, D, E, and/or K, whether in their natural or synthetic forms, (ii) a Non-Steroidal Anti Inflammatory (NSAID) product which contains acetaminophen, ibuprofen, acetylsalicylic acid, diclofenac, indomethacin, and piroxicam, or substances similar thereto; or (iii) a nicotine or nicotine analog; (iv) an antiviral drug; (v) a phosphodiesterase type 5 inhibitor; (vi) a hormone; or (vii) any other active substance not specifically named and allowed within this Agreement.

Active Substances. PB or its affiliates will sell certain Active Substances ("Active Substances") to Pfizer to enable Pfizer to manufacture, formulate and distribute the Products. Pfizer will purchase from PB its requirements of Active Substances which were being supplied from Pfizer affiliates prior to the date of this Agreement. Active Substances purchased by PB from Pfizer or an affiliate of Pfizer shall be resold to Pfizer at the same price paid by PB. Active Substances manufactured by PB shall be sold to Pfizer at PB's standard cost of manufacture. Specifications for Active Substances are as listed on Exhibit B subject to the provisions of paragraph 9 below. Each sale shall be accompanied by a certificate of conformity issued by PB. Expiry dating on all such Active Substances will be such that Pfizer shall be able to do any local formulating and sell all Products in the normal course of its business, as conducted prior to the date hereof.

Active Substances. Nothing in this Agreement infers applicability of the Technology by LICENSEE for enabling active substance incorporation and potentiation in LICENSEE’s End Products, other than derived from hemp as an ingredient comprising not less than 10% of the active ingredients in the End Product. LICENSEE is prohibited from developing, manufacturing or selling, whether directly or indirectly, including through its Partner, in each Territory, any Product Lines that are marketed as the following types of products WITHOUT the incorporation of hemp: (i) a fat soluble vitamin product for vitamins A, D, E, and/or K, whether in their natural or synthetic forms; (ii) a Non-Steroidal Anti Inflammatory (NSAID) product including, but not limited to, acetaminophen, ibuprofen, acetylsalicylic acid, diclofenac, indomethacin, and piroxicam; or (iii) a nicotine product. LICENSEE is permitted to incorporate other active substances within their Product Lines and the Parties agree that the End Products as defined will always be hemp-infused and will always contain less than the Local THC Limit and shall only be distributed and/or sold in the Permitted Locations; and the Parties further agree that any such End Products that incorporate active substances beyond those derived from hemp shall still fall under one of the Product Line classifications as defined in Section 1 with all associated obligations by the LICENSEE; and the Parties further agree there is no requirement to pay more than one set of fees as described in Exhibit C regardless of whether more than a single active substance is utilized in any given product.
